salad goes down well and easily and I can eat large amounts of it, as I can steamed veges. But the way I see it, that's not a problem anyway, they're so low in calories and so high in all the good stuff your body needs. As long as it feels like its going through and not building up and stretching your pouch - ie. you're not eating past fullness, I"d eat as much as I wanted of these sorts of things. They're nothing but good for you.

Just avoid the fatty dressings.< /p>

I asked my dietian about eating salad. I told her that a cup of salad just wasn't enough. She told me that i could eat a saucer size serving of salad because it has a high Water content. She also suggested adding some meat to the salad for the Protein. I went to a buffet tonight and ate a medium size bowl of salad. I also ate a chicken tender and an onion ring. I ate a tiny serving of ice cream. I felt very full and satisfied. Salads are the only food that I eat over a cupful of. So far, it hasn't hurt my weight loss.
